"Never Keeping Secrets" is the second single released from Babyface's album For the Cool in You. It peaked at number 15 on the U.S. Hot 100 chart and at no. 3 on the U.S. R&B chart.

The song was performed by J.P. Molfetta on American Idol.[1]
A cover of the song by Spragga Benz and Wayne Wonder reached number 1 in Jamaica in 1994.[2]
